The invention relates to a process for obtaining a mixture of fuels by reacting carbon monoxide with hydrogen in the presence of a zinc and chromium catalyst, optionally in the presence of copper and alkali metals at a pressure of 300 ... 200 atm and temperatures of 220 DEG C. to 500 DEG C. to which, after cooling, the reaction mixture is subjected to a temperature of 160 DEG-220 DEG C. over a catalyst containing 31.4% ZnO, 49.9% Cr2O3 and 18.7% , after which the separation of a gaseous phase which is sent to the absorption of CO2 and a liquid phase which after stripping is used as an absorption liquid is carried out. |
